Output 17a229f8b708cd4623c52631587eda0633c9d7f7bd90c8b403f4c77f297323a6:3

value
49996799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b020fca2109f26d59128c0bc36679762c79918b9 OP_EQUAL
address
MPxSgAAB2HQvRjzbbgUhggHDdAumaFv7jD
transaction
17a229f8b708cd4623c52631587eda0633c9d7f7bd90c8b403f4c77f297323a6
spent
true